Transaction

66db6cf907bc3cb65b666fdea3f08c063fad368e3f3d606fbd4b9daec4f40bc3

Summary

In Block116858
TimeTue, 28 Mar 2023 11:59:45 UTC
Total Input928.96419271 Nebula
Total Output983.96419271 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
850794 Confirmations983.96419271 Nebula
Raw Transaction